Movies of Douglas Kennedy and Lee Phelps together

Douglas Kennedy and Lee Phelps have starred in 9 movies together. Their first film was 'G' Men in 1935. The most recent movie that Douglas Kennedy and Lee Phelps starred together was Gun Belt in 1953.
